Obesity Is Epidemic
This epidemic contributes to a host of chronic diseases and causes a greater likelihood of premature death.
It is driven by changes in the physical, social, and economic environment that make it easy to take in more calories than needed while making it harder to get enough physical activity to consume those extra calories.
Definitions
Someone who is overweight has a body mass index (BMI) of 25 to 29.9.
Someone who is obese has a body mass index (BMI) of 30 or more.
